Storytelling
Introdução
Essa técnica de elicitação tem como foco elicitar requisitos a partir de histórias contadas pelos usuários, em que são descritas ocasiões, atividades e/ou sentimentos relacionados à utilização do app ou às tarefas realizadas. A partir destas histórias podemos saber o que esses usuários fazem no seu cotidiano, para quê eles usam o app do Grasshopper, quais são suas nescessidades e quais os sentimentos do usuário ao realizar determinadas tarefas. E por fim, podemos, então, realizar a elicitação de requisitos a partir de tais histórias.
Storytelling
Para o desenvolvimento destas Storytellings, nós utilizaremos dos questionários respondidos pelos usuários e das personas desenvolvidas a partir dos perfis de usuários coletados.
Paulo de Sampaio
Paulo em seu dia a dia como engenheiro aeroespacial sempre possui muitos problemas matemáticos que levam muito tempo para serem resolvidos. A partir de tal situação, começou a procurar por softwares que pudessem resolver seu problemas, mas muitos requeriam uma lógica de programação pelo menos básica para usá-los. Tendo isto em vista, começou a buscar por cursos de programação para satisfazer sua nescessidade. Com isso, encontrou o app do Grasshopper que fornecia a lógica de programação de forma gamificada, rápida e gratuita, fazendo com que Paulo não precisasse sair de sua rotina para fazer o curso e nem levasse muito tempo para aprender.
Roberta Paiva
Roberta acaba de terminar o ensino médio sem um emprego, mas com um foco certo, se tornar programadora. Com este foco, ela busca encontrar cursos de programação para iniciar na carreira, e como muitos fazem, pesquisa diretamente no Google em busca de cursos de linguagem de programação. Como recomendação, a pesquisa indica app de ensino de programação da Google a ela. Logo, por confiar na empresa, ela opta por começar a usar o aplicativo, sem ter nenhuma noção de como programa.
João Falcão
João está em seu 3° semestre na UnB. Seu curso de engenharia de software cria uma nescessidade de que o aluno precissa aprender a programar. Com este problema em vista, João faz uma pesquisa sobre quais linguagens de programação estão em alta e observa que JavaScript é uma delas. Com essa informação, João busca na internet por cursos de JavaScript e encontra o app do Grasshopper. Como recomendação de amigos, fica interessado pois o app conta com uma trilha a ser seguida e de forma gamificada. Então, João, com uma base em programação, se aventura no app de estudos com o foco de melhorar suas habilidades e crescer profissionalmente.
Elicitação de Requisitos
A partir das histórias desenvolvidas, foram elicitados requisitos funcionais (Tabela 1) e não-funcionais (Tabela 2).
Legenda:
- ST: Storytelling
Requisitos Funcionais
ID | Descrição |
---|---|
ST01 | Eu, como usuário, gostaria de definir meus horários de estudo, para poder se encaixar em meu horário de trabalho |
ST02 | Eu, como usuário, gostaria de realizar tarefas focadas em lógica, para aprender o que nescessito mais rápido |
ST03 | Eu, como usuário, gostaria de navegar entre as tarefas, para poder buscar as relevantes para mim |
ST04 | Eu, como usuário, gostaria de realizar tarefas relacionadas a cálculos matemáticos, para poder aplicar em meu dia a dia |
ST06 | Eu, como usuário, gostaria de logar na aplicação com minha conta da Google, para facilitar meu login |
ST09 | Eu, como usuário, gostaria de ter um sistema para treinar meus conhecimentos, para aperfeiçoar meu conhecimento |
ST11 | Eu, como usuário, gostaria de definir o nível de dificuldade das minhas tarefas, para nivelar com meu conhecimento |
ST13 | Eu, como usuário, gostaria de acompanhar meu avanço, para ter noção de como estou indo nos estudos |
Requisitos Não-Funcionais
ID | Descrição |
---|---|
ST05 | Eu, como usuário, gostaria de aprender do zero como programar, para aprender a programar |
ST07 | Eu, como usuário, gostaria de aprender uma linguagem de programação, para poder me capacitar |
ST08 | Eu, como usuário, gostaria de ter uma trilha de ensinamentos para seguir, para ter um guia de estudos |
ST10 | Eu, como usuário, gostaria de um material de apoio, para ter mais conteúdos para estudar |
ST12 | Eu, como usuário, gostaria de ter um passo a passo para realizar as tarefas, para aprender de forma fácil |
ST14 | Eu, como usuário, gostaria de aprender sobre as bibliotecas da linguagem, para aumentar o escopo dos meus conhecimentos |
ST15 | Eu, como usuário, gostaria de ter ensino gratuito, para ser mais acessível as minhas condições |
Gravação da Elicitação
Referências
Storytelling: o que é, técnicas e como fazer histórias incríveis. Disponível em: https://rockcontent.com/br/talent-blog/storytelling/#:~:text=Storytelling%20%C3%A9%20um%20termo%20em,uma%20mensagem%20de%20forma%20inesquec%C3%ADvel.. Acesso em: 26 nov. 2022.
Histórico de versão
Versão | Data | Descrição | Autor | Revisor |
---|---|---|---|---|
1.0 | 26/11/2022 | Criado os Storytelling | Wildemberg Sales | Caio Vitor |
1.1 | 26/11/2022 | Criado elicitação do storytelling | Wildemberg Sales, Phelipe de Souza | Caio Vitor |
1.2 | 27/11/2022 | Conserto da gravação | Lucas Lopes | Wildemberg Sales |
1.3 | 29/11/2022 | Mudança no formato da tabela | João Pedro | Wildemberg Sales |
1.4 | 26/12/2022 | Correções da verificação | Lucas Lopes | Wildemberg Sales |